Seller concessions are financial incentives or contributions from the seller that help reduce the buyers out-of-pocket expenses. The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) allows these concessions to cover up to 4% of the loan amount, but they must be items outside of standard closing costs.
How long do you have to occupy a home purchased with a VA loan? Generally, homebuyers have 60 days from closing to occupy a home purchased with a VA loan. However, the VA does allow homebuyers in certain situations to go beyond the 60-day mark, potentially extending up to one year.
The VA requires all mortgage applicants to furnish a form designating a nearest living relative. Its not a standardized, official VA form but rather a letter or lender generated form stating who the veterans family contact is in case the VA has lost touch with the borrower.

The Department of Veterans Affairs requires all VA borrowers to provide the lender with the name, address and phone number of their nearest living relative.
